polytype

CIDE DICTIONARY

polytypen. [Poly- + -type: cf. F. polytype, a.].
     A cast, or facsimile copy, of an engraved block, matter in type, etc.; as, a polytype in relief  [Webster 1913 Suppl.]
    "By pressing the wood cut into semifluid metal, an intaglio matrix is produced: and from this matrix, in a similar way, a polytype in relief is obtained."  [1913 Webster]
polytypea. 
     Of or pertaining to polytypes; obtained by polytyping; as, a polytype plate.  [1913 Webster]
polytypev. t. 
     To produce a polytype of; as, to polytype an engraving.  [1913 Webster]
